#b6dc16 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b6dc16 is composed of 71.4% red, 86.3%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 90%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 71.5 degrees, a saturation of 81.8% and a lightness of 47.5%. #b6dc16 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ff2c with #6db900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

#b6dc16 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b6dc16 has RGB values of R:182, G:220,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0, Y:0.9,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 11983894.
